The DeWalt DW089K 3-Beam Line Laser earns our top spot for its exceptional accuracy and versatility. Designed for professionals, this self-leveling laser projects three bright, clear beams—horizontal, vertical, and side—for precise 90-degree layouts. With a working range of up to 165 feet (with a detector), it’s ideal for large job sites. The durable, over-molded housing withstands tough conditions, and the included kit comes with a case and batteries. We loved its micro-adjust knob for fine-tuning and the 1/8-inch accuracy at 30 feet. Pros: Outstanding build quality, long range, easy to use. Cons: Pricey for casual users. If you’re serious about precision, this is the best laser level of 2025 for both indoor and outdoor projects.
As our Editor's Choice, the Bosch GLL3-330CG stands out with its cutting-edge green beam technology, offering up to 4x brighter visibility than red lasers, even in bright conditions. This 360-degree laser projects three planes for full-room layouts, with a range of 200 feet (with a receiver). Its Bluetooth connectivity lets you control settings via a smartphone app—a game-changer for tech-savvy users. The self-leveling feature and CAL Guard calibration monitoring ensure consistent accuracy. Pros: Superior visibility, smart features, robust design. Cons: High price point. Perfect for contractors needing a premium laser level in 2025, this tool is worth every penny for complex projects.

For those on a tight budget, the Black+Decker BDL220S Laser Level is a fantastic choice without sacrificing functionality. This compact tool projects both horizontal and vertical lines with a 360-degree rotating wall attachment for hands-free use. While it’s not self-leveling, it includes a built-in bubble vial for manual accuracy, making it great for small DIY tasks like hanging pictures or shelves. The range is limited to 10 feet, but it’s perfect for indoor use. Pros: Affordable, easy to use, versatile attachment. Cons: Short range, not ideal for large projects. As the best budget laser level of 2025, it’s a solid pick for casual users.
The Huepar 621CG Green Laser Level offers excellent value with its bright green beams, which are far more visible than traditional red lasers. This self-leveling tool projects a 360-degree horizontal line and two vertical lines, covering full-room layouts with a 180-foot range (with a detector). Its durable design includes shock resistance, and the USB charging feature adds convenience. We appreciated the multiple mounting options for flexibility on job sites. Pros: Bright visibility, long battery life, budget-friendly for pros. Cons: Slightly bulky. A top contender among green laser levels in 2025, it’s great for both DIYers and professionals.
The Makita SK105DNAX Cross-Line Laser is a reliable choice for contractors who need durability and precision. This self-leveling laser projects crisp horizontal and vertical lines with a range of up to 115 feet (with a receiver). Its compact design and rubberized grip make it easy to handle, while the 18V LXT battery compatibility ensures long runtime for Makita tool users. The accuracy of 1/8 inch at 30 feet is impressive for the price. Pros: Solid build, good range, battery versatility. Cons: No 360-degree coverage. A strong mid-range laser level for 2025, it’s ideal for medium-sized projects.
The Leica Lino L2P5G combines green beam technology with point and line projection for ultimate versatility. With a range of up to 115 feet, this self-leveling laser offers pinpoint accuracy for tasks like plumbing and alignment. Its rugged, dust- and water-resistant design suits tough environments, and the rechargeable battery lasts up to 28 hours. The green beams are highly visible, even outdoors. Pros: Excellent durability, long battery life, bright beams. Cons: Expensive for casual use. A premium option among the best laser levels of 2025, it’s perfect for professionals needing reliability.
The Stabila LAR 160 G is a powerhouse for outdoor projects, with a green beam rotary laser that offers a massive 2000-foot range with a receiver. Fully self-leveling in both horizontal and vertical modes, it’s ideal for grading, landscaping, and large construction sites. Its IP65 rating ensures resistance to dust and water, while the shock-absorbent casing adds durability. Pros: Incredible range, tough build, precise leveling. Cons: Bulky, high cost. For heavy-duty tasks, this is one of the top laser levels of 2025 for outdoor professionals.
The Topcon RL-H5A Rotary Laser Level is a go-to for large-scale construction projects, boasting a 2600-foot working range with a receiver. This self-leveling rotary laser delivers ±1/16-inch accuracy at 100 feet, making it perfect for grading and excavation. Its IP66 rating ensures it withstands harsh weather, and the long battery life (up to 100 hours) keeps you working. Pros: Unmatched range, high accuracy, weatherproof. Cons: Expensive, overkill for small jobs. A top-tier choice for 2025, it’s built for serious outdoor applications.
The Johnson Level & Tool 40-0921 is a reliable cross-line laser for indoor and light outdoor use. This self-leveling tool projects bright horizontal and vertical lines with a 150-foot range (with a detector). Its locking mechanism protects the pendulum during transport, and the included tripod mount adds versatility. The accuracy of 1/8 inch at 50 feet suits most home projects. Pros: User-friendly, good range, affordable. Cons: Limited durability outdoors. A solid mid-range laser level for 2025, it’s great for DIY enthusiasts.
The Klein Tools 93LCLS Cross-Line Laser Level is a compact, practical option for electricians and small-scale contractors. This self-leveling laser projects sharp horizontal and vertical lines, plus plumb spots, with a 65-foot range. Its durable, water- and dust-resistant body is built for job site conditions, and the integrated magnetic mount offers hands-free convenience. Pros: Compact, rugged, versatile mounting. Cons: Limited range for large projects. A dependable choice among 2025 laser levels, it’s ideal for targeted, smaller tasks.
